Travel with us to one of the last insider tips in the Mediterranean. The Lipari Islands or the Aeolian Islands (derived from the Roman wind god Aiolos, Latin Aeolus) are true pearls in the north of Sicily and can only be reached by boat. This group of islands includes Lipari, Salina, Vulcano, Stromboli, Filicudi, Alicudi and Panarea. Geologically, historically, culinary and culturally, as well as for their breathtaking beauty, these islands are worth a visit. The island or better the active volcano Stromboli, as the only permanently active volcano in Europe, belongs to the absolute highlight of our trip. The trip will take place on board of a well maintained sailing yacht, which will be our means of transport and at the same time our accommodation for the next days. Whether in the safe harbor with subsequent shore leave or in a beautiful bay where you can greet the sunrise with a jump into the water, the freedom we can enjoy here is boundless. A trip for adventurous, cultural and culinary travelbuddies who want to create impressions far away from normal destinations.

Portorosa Marina Yachting

Day 1-2
Our home port is best reached from Catania airport after an already very scenic cab ride. From Catania, located directly at the foot of Etna, the road leads us north through a breathtaking landscape that was strongly influenced by Etna. At the northernmost point near Messina, Sicily and the Italian mainland are only a stone's throw away from each other. Arrived in the home port we start with a cozy get together, then move into the boat and provide enough provisions for the next days. Right next to the harbor is one of the most beautiful sandy beaches in Sicily (Spiaggia di Furnari) which is definitely worth a visit.

Vulcano

Day 2-3
Our first ettap destination is the island of Vulcano. The island is about 3 hours drive from our home port and our berth can be reached in a good 4 hours. There we will anchor, depending on the weather conditions in the west or east of the island near Porto di Ponente and spend a wonderful day and night at the foot of the eponymous volcano Vulcano. By the way, the name volcano was derived from names of this island and can be found phonetically in many languages.

Panarea

Day 3-4
Panarea is the smallest and most picturesque of the Aeolian Islands. It is also the most exclusive and many celebrities have created a haven here in recent years. Panarea is also about 4 hours drive from our anchorage in Vulcano.

Stromboli

Day 4-5
The Stromboli volcano with its impressive fireworks at night is just 3 hours away from Panarea. There we spend a leisurely afternoon until we leave strengthened in the evening in the direction of the fire spectacle of glowing and molten rock. Afterwards we set course for Salina already in the early night and will arrive there in the early morning.

Salina

Day 5
Salina is the second largest island of the Lipari Islands and is almost completely protected. Here we can spend a relaxing morning in Pollara Bay in the west of the island or a whole day in Proto Turistico in the east of the island. (Depending on your mood) In the evening we will go to the name-giving island - Lipari.

Lipari

Day 5-6
The largest of the Lipari Islands - Lipari, is a stone's throw from Salina. Our destination is the largest port in the archipelago directly north of the town of Lipari. After about 2 hours driving time we reach this and that is also good. Lipari invites to a leisurely stroll through town and the island itself to various hikes.
